Hi There really hoping someone might have the answer for this. This is a leak from when it rains. This is the drivers door above the wheel arch where the cables go through to the door. The water is getting between the two inner panels and not draining away so when I brake the water works it’s way over the lip and floods the carpet / flooring. Question is should water even be in between these panels in the first place. It’s a camper conversion and had a Reimo pop top fitted. Can’t find the source. 6A8064CC-E293-4E2F-935E-122A8C5B8AD4.png

just seen a thread on another sight same issue on a T6, there are no drain holes in there so any water going down the A pillar leaks into this area, having drains drilled off but would be nice to stop the water at source, tried sealing roof bar bolts and reimo roof bolts just can’t stop it coming in when it rains?
